A miniature model of the F-86 Sabre. The F-86 Sabre served extensively in the Korean War. The Sabre's rival, the MiG 15, performed better than the Sabre, but pilot training, and advanced technology, (for the time) allowed the F-86 to have a very high kill-loss ratio. It was exported to England in a highly upgraded version, and to Thailand. Thailand also bought the AIM 9 Sidewinder. Interestingly, a Thaiwanese Sabre engaged Chinese MiGs, and fired the new Sidewinders. One hit a MiG, but did not explode, (due to the newness of the technology) allowing the MiG pilot to land his plane safely. Using the sidewinder as a prototype, the Chinese and the Russians copied the missile, and used it until they developed their own.
